5. Legal Basis for Processing (GDPR)
For users located in the European Economic Area (EEA), the United Kingdom, and Switzerland, we process your personal data on the following legal bases as defined by the General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R):
- Consent (Article 6(1)(a)): Where you have given clear, informed, and unambiguous consent for us to process your personal data for specific purposes, such as receiving marketing communications or enabling optional features.
- Performance of a Contract (Article 6(1)(b)): Processing that is necessary to fulfill our contractual obligations to you, including providing the Service, managing your account, delivering purchased content and subscriptions, and delivering the features you have requested.
- Legitimate Interests (Article 6(1)(f)): Processing that is necessary for our legitimate business interests, such as improving the Service, ensuring security, preventing fraud, and conducting analytics, provided these interests are not overridden by your fundamental rights and freedoms.
- Legal Obligation (Article 6(1)(c)): Processing that is necessary to comply with legal obligations to which we are subject, including tax laws, financial record-keeping requirements, data retention requirements, and law enforcement requests.
6. Your Rights Under GDPR
If you are a resident of the European Economic Area (EEA), the United Kingdom, or Switzerland, you have the following rights regarding your personal data:
- Right of Access (Article 15): You have the right to request a copy of the personal data we hold about you, along with information about how it is being processed.
- Right to Rectification (Article 16): You have the right to request that we correct any inaccurate or incomplete personal data we hold about you.
- Right to Erasure (Article 17): You have the right to request that we delete your personal data, subject to certain legal exceptions. This is also known as the "right to be forgotten."
- Right to Restriction of Processing (Article 18): You have the right to request that we restrict the processing of your personal data under certain circumstances.
- Right to Data Portability (Article 20): You have the right to receive your personal data in a structured, commonly used, and machine-readable format, and to transmit that data to another controller.
- Right to Object (Article 21): You have the right to object to the processing of your personal data where we are relying on legitimate interests as the legal basis, including processing for direct marketing purposes.
- Right to Withdraw Consent (Article 7(3)): Where processing is based on your consent, you have the right to withdraw that consent at any time without affecting the lawfulness of processing carried out prior to the withdrawal.
- Right to Lodge a Complaint: You have the right to lodge a complaint with a supervisory authority in the EU member state of your habitual residence, your place of work, or the place of the alleged infringement.
